    施骞 博士,现为同济大学经济与管理学院副院长,建设管理与房地产系教授,博士生导师,美国项目管理学会PMI-GAC理事,CPEC理事,上海市土木工程学会理事、管理专业委员会主任委员,上海市工程管理学会副理事长,靠前设施管理学会(IFMA)上海区原主席。曾获得欧盟Erasmus Mundus学者基金资助,在美国出版学术专著1部,参与靠前标准(ISO/TC279)WG3工作组工作、参与国家标准(GB/T50430-2007)编制。担任Renewable and Sustainable Energy Review、European Journal of Operational Research、International Journal of Project Management、Automation in Construction、ASCE-Journal of Urban Planning and Development等靠前期刊的审稿人。主要教学和科研领域包括:工程管理、项目管理、风险管理等。

    《大型重点建设项目风险管理》吸收国内外优选、非常不错的项目风险管理理论和方法体系,整合了研究界和实践界的团队,理论和实践相结合。
